June 20 is the deadline to file.

(Franklin County, Ind.) - Neysa R. Raible, Franklin Circuit Court Clerk, advises that Tuesday, May 21, 2024 is the first day that an individual may file (CAN-34) a petition of nomination and consent for a school board member must be filed along with (CAN-12) statement of economic interest.
Thursday, June 20, 2024, by NOON, is the deadline to file a petition of nomination with the county election board as a school board member at the general election. MUSH be accompanied by a State of Economic Interest (CAN-12)
The following School Board Offices will be on the General ballot:
FRANKLIN COUNTY COMMUNITY SCHOOL CORPORATION:
District 1 – One member (running district includes Laurel, Metamora, Posey, and the part of Salt Creek contained in the Franklin County Community School Corporation)
District 2 – One member (running district includes Blooming Grove, Fairfield, and Brookville 4 &5)
District 3 – One member (running district includes Brookville 1, 2 & 3, Highland 1, and the part of Butler contained in the Franklin County Community School Cooperation)
District 4 – One member (running district includes Highland 2, Springfield & Whitewater 1 & 2)
